PRINCIPA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

Develops short term and long term schedules and gains commitments from subcontractors and suppliers to achieve mutual goals

Manages all day-to-day construction activities from mobilization through punch list completion in an efficient and productive manner including, but not limited to:
Scheduling of subcontractors and suppliers
Scheduling of delivery of equipment and materials
Coordination of all needed inspections
Acquisition of occupancy permits
Preparation and completion of punch lists within 2 weeks of punch walk
Daily interaction with Project Managers, Project Coordinators, Architects, Engineers, Clients and Client's Tenants
Studies and understands all plans, specifications and contracts to allow efficient and timely coordination of work and proactive problem solving
Monitor and verify subcontractor work to ensure compliance with plans, specifications and standard industry practices for a high quality project
Coordinates all required testing and inspections
Conducts and documents weekly job meetings with subcontractors on site or planned to be on site prior to the next meeting
Conduct pre-installation meetings with contractors for critical systems such as facade details, window systems, MEP coordination, etc.
Manages cost control of General Conditions expenses
Control the day-to-day decision-making regarding project sequencing utilizing a 3 week look ahead
Prepares project specific site staging plan
Conduct and document subcontractor orientation meetings prior to their commencement of work
Maintains the record set of as-built drawings and coordinates completion of all close-out documents
Prepares and manages a project specific safety plan and manage implementation of the ICSI safety program
Preparation of detailed weekly paperwork including daily reports, weekly reports, weekly safety toolbox talks, weekly safety inspections, 3 week look ahead schedules, weekly expense reports, daily and weekly photos, etc.
Prepare RFIs and submit for issues requiring clarification and coordinate with the PM and PC
Maintain a rolling punch list and manage timely completion on a weekly basis
Coordinate transfer of all utilities to the appropriate parties
Attend and participate in quarterly company meetings when scheduled
Exhibits sound and accurate judgement
Maintains professionalism with all parties while performing its duties
Other duties as required or assigned
